Scientists from Microsoft Research have proposed using existing commercial aircraft flights and air routes to provide worldwide internet coverage at much lower cost than proposed solutions such as Google?s Project Loon (which uses balloons) and Facebook?s Aquila efforts (which uses solar-powered aircraft).

It looks like Microsoft outfitted an RV10 for initial testing. It would be interesting to hear more about this project.
